Metro Police have arrested a man accused in several robberies.
IMPD Sgt. Paul Thompson says officers responded to an armed robbery shortly before 11:00 a.m. Wednesday to a Long John Silver's at 3230 Southeastern Avenue.
35-year-old Jeremy Tomlin is accused of riding to the restaurant on a bike, showing a knife and making off with some cash.
Police arrived and chased Tomlin for a short time before he jumped off and ran. He was found nearby hiding in a child's homemade fort.
Thompson says Tomlin had confessed to the Long John Silver's robbery and at least three others.
